The Story of Maliah

Maliah is a variant spelling of Malia, the Hawaiian form of Mary/Maria, derived from the Hebrew Miriam meaning beloved or wished-for child. In Hawaiian, the name carries the warmth and beauty of the islands. The -iah ending makes Maliah feel more aligned with popular names like Aaliyah and Mariah, blending Hawaiian beauty with the melodic -iah suffix beloved in contemporary American naming.

Maliah gained visibility in part due to Malia Obama, the eldest daughter of President Barack Obama, which brought the Malia/Maliah names to widespread attention during his presidency (2009-2017). The variant spelling Maliah appeals to parents who want the Malia sound with a more distinctive look.

In Hawaiian culture, Malia/Maliah reflects the Hawaiian tradition of naming that honors Mary, particularly in Catholic Hawaiian communities. The name beautifully embodies the aloha spirit.
